1) THE MEGA POWERS ARE BACK BABY! Well at least Axelmania and Macho Mandow are apparently a team now. I have this as one of my thoughts as we recently saw a solo promo from Damian Sandow where he was solidly backed by the crowd and the crowd seem to love this Axelmania gimmick too and they will go nuts when he wins a match. So why stick them both into a team when they both just got out of disappointing teams (Rybaxel and Mizdow). Not sure where this is going but I’m a fan of both guys. Lets ride out this “We have no idea what to do with these guys, make them a tag team” moment of booking.

2) THE WYATT FAMILY ARE BACK! Or at least Harper and Rowan are back together. This is a step in the right direction, WWE. Now just get them back with Bray. Please? They were so good together, SO GOOD. And without him, Harper and Rowan are just 2 big guys that can’t cut a promo worth a damn and can’t really get over solo. As a tag team they work better as Bray’s lackeys. You know it makes sense team. DO IT!

3)ADRIAN NEV…er… JUST NEVILLE: There is a very familiar chant among the WWE crowd one where they repeat the phrase “Same Old Sh*t!” over and over again, much like the person they are chanting at. So why is it that after about a month or so on the main roster I feel like that chant is exactly what Neville is giving us. You’ll hear me and a couple of other discuss this in this week’s Declassified; but when Adrian is on the offensive in a match, and he is not doing a huge high spot, he looks somewhat lost in the ring, and the spots he is doing are the same spots he’s been doing for a long time. The more he wrestles, the more he becomes Evan Bourne.

4) DOES THE WWE PLAN ANYTHING EVER? Last night it was revealed that May 31st the WWE will air a WWE network exclusive event “ELIMINATION CHAMBER”. This is about 2 weeks notice (and is right between 2 PPVS). This leaves them 2 weeks to set up the angle for EC and then 2 weeks to set up the angles for Money in the Bank. This is also hot on the heels of 24 hours notice going into King of the Ring. You know WWE if you announced these things a couple months ahead of time you could build excitement. I know you are currently trying to put of this “We could do anything at anytime so subscribe” kinda thing…but it’s not working for ya.

5) THE ELEPHANT IN THE ROOM. Daniel Bryan. And here is where I’m going to go off the rails for a bit. Last night D-Bry relinquished the IC title. He also made it clear that he doesn’t know when he will return to action or if he ever will be able to. I have come at this in 2 ways looking at Bryan Danielson the Person and looking at Daniel Bryan the Wrestling character.

So lets start by looking at Bryan Danielson, the person.

I harbor no ill feelings toward him and it absolutely sucks that he is in the position and I feel bad for him and his fans. But at least a little bit of it is brought on by himself, the absolute refusal to change his style in any way after major neck surgery, when a lot of his moves impart major impact on the neck area. Also last night’s promo did NOTHING to help him. Coming out and basically for 10 minutes going “All the brass in WWE were going to bury me and you forced them to do otherwise” burns a lot of bridges, and sets a dangerous precedent if he DOES return because every time he loses a match we get the God awful situation that happened after the Royal Rumble this year where fans wanted to hold the WWE hostage rather than let them tell the story they wanted to tell. But again it sucks that Bryan is hurt in this fashion.

How to look at Daniel Bryan, the wrestling character.

DING DONG THE WITCH IS DEAD! And in this case the witch is the situation of mystery. I cannot lie, I’ve never been much of a Daniel Bryan fan. At all. I can see why people love him and his work, but I just haven’t ever been a fan of his (and I’m going to be honest when the whole trying to hold the WWE hostage over him not being in the main event thing happened, it colored my opinion of him even more) so I’m glad he is no longer the champion. Mainly because it gets the IC belt (my favorite title) out of this weird limbo it’s been living in ever since he won it. Between WWE not wanting to tell us he was hurt for the longest time, to them confirming he was hurt but not what it was, to not telling us what was going on with the IC belt… it’s been nothing but a circus. Also I’ll be very surprised if He ever holds a major championship in the WWE again. This is the second title he’s had to surrender due to injury and the second time he has had to head out for an undetermined amount of time in less than a year. H e also wasn’t back in action more than 4-5 months and for at least one of those he was working hurt already.

I hope that Bryan gets well and takes care of himself and his family. As for the wrestling world, the last time he got hurt, the WWE fell back on Dolph Ziggler. Lets hope they do so again. Or at least I’m going to hope that.
